4961
4961 is a natural number that comes after 4960 and before 4962. In mathematics, it is composite with prime factorization 4961 = 11^2 × 41, so its divisors are 1, 11, 41, 121, 451, and 4961. The sum of digits is 20, giving a digital root of 2, and 4961 is congruent to 1 modulo 4.

In various numeral systems, 4961 is represented as 0x1361 in hexadecimal and 1001101100001_2 in binary.
